Dr. Teamor is a distinguished leader and advocate, serving as the executive director of Calvary House Military Support since 2009. In this role, she has dedicated herself to finding spaces to assist others, particularly veterans, by establishing partnerships with organizations like United Way to provide support for those at risk of suicide. Her commitment to service extends to her position as senior pastor at Mount Olive Multicultural Community Church, a congregation founded by her father, where she has been leading since 2007.
Dr. Teamor's career began at IBM, where she made history as the youngest regional operations coordinator at 21, managing five states from 1994 to 1996. She then transitioned to Achip Technologies Inc., where she served as product manager and field marketing director from 1996 to 1999. Her entrepreneurial spirit led her to Detroit Public Schools, where she managed the IMT Entrepreneurship Program from 2002 to 2009, fostering innovation and leadership among students.
In addition to her professional roles, Dr. Teamor is an accomplished author and has been a ghostwriter with Dzata Publishing since 2005. Her literary works primarily focus on Christian and historical fiction, and she is currently working on a biography of a woman who served as a cosmetologist and beautician for Motown artists and provided those same services in the modern film industry. Dr. Teamor's creative endeavors also include singing; she used to perform the national anthem for the National Hockey Association Junior League and released a gospel CD with the Victory In Praise Choir group.
Dr. Teamor's educational background is extensive and diverse. She earned a Doctor of Theology in systematic theology from the Newburgh Theological Seminary in 2009. By1999, she had completed two degrees at Hamilton College: a Doctor of Philosophy in business marketing and a Master of Business Administration. Her academic journey began with an Associate of Arts in liberal arts from Oakland Community College in 1994, followed by a Bachelor of Science in business administration from William Tyndale College in 1996. Additionally, she became a licensed minister in 2001 and an ordained minister in 2002. These achievements have equipped her with the knowledge and skills necessary for her multifaceted career.
Dr. Teamor's dedication to service is further exemplified through her involvement with various organizations such as American Baptist Churches USA, where she serves on the regional board, Optimist International, Detroit Youth Overcoming Challenges, SkillsUSA, the Detroit Executive Service Corps, and the Detroit Regional Chamber of Commerce. Her contributions have been recognized with accolades from Who's Who Among American Teachers and several awards from SkillsUSA, the Birmingham Public School District, the Southfield Public School District, the Detroit Association of Black Social Workers, the Detroit Executive Service Corps, the Detroit Public Schools Community District, and IBM.

Additionally, Dr. Teamor takes great pride in her service to veterans. One story that stands out to her involves a veteran family that lost their home to a fire. The family had two young children with another on the way. In response, Dr. Teamor and Calvary House organized an event called "CamoFabulous," where local designers created clothing from camouflage and military-inspired materials. Participants from the Modeling School of Barbizon helped model the clothing, while others provided hair and makeup services. The most memorable aspect of the event was when the National Guard arrived. Although Dr. Teamor was there to assist them, the Guard Soldiers surprised her by presenting her with various honors and awards. She was genuinely astonished, as she had never expected any recognition. They awarded her a challenge coin, explaining that in the history of their unit, they had only given out three, making her the fourth recipient.
Looking ahead, Dr. Teamor envisions her church becoming a premier online community that demonstrates to others how to build connections beyond the traditional church setting, serving as a model for those seeking to establish similar communities. She is also committed to supporting as many veterans and their families as possible through a program her organization is currently developing called "RVs for Vets." Their goal is to secure grants to renovate and rebuild RVs, allowing veterans to stay at campgrounds that offer permanent residency. This will not only reduce homelessness among veterans, but it will also provide them with permanent addresses, which are required for accessing benefits. Additionally, Dr. Teamor intends to continue an existing program, "Vet Pets," expanding this initiative across the country.
